How Do Manufacturers Use QMS Software Solutions?
Manufacturing QMS software handles quality work inside manufacturing operations, not only during audits.
Teams use quality management software to manage document control, employee training, and nonconformance, audit, and risk management.
That replaces manual processes with repeatable QMS processes that teams follow without relying on reminders.
On the factory floor, manufacturing quality management software provides access to approved work instructions, product specifications, and version control for quality documents.
Supervisors verify employee training before assigning tasks. Quality teams record quality events, customer complaints, and quality issues as they occur.
That creates reliable quality data connected to manufacturing processes.
Why Manufacturers Rely on QMS Software
Manufacturing QMS software fixes gaps in quality management processes that manual systems leave behind.
Quality processes fail when procedures change, but production processes don’t follow. That leads to inconsistent product quality and customer complaints.
Traceability is another issue. When quality issues surface, teams often lack reliable quality data to connect defects, approvals, and corrective actions.
Quality management system software keeps records linked, so decision-making doesn’t rely on assumptions.
Supplier quality management also creates risk. Poor supplier performance and missed inspections affect raw materials and finished products. QMS software records supplier issues and corrective actions so problems don’t repeat.
Regulatory compliance solutions expose weak systems fast. Industry regulations require complete documentation and proof of continuous improvement.
Digital QMS solutions help manufacturers meet compliance requirements and maintain quality standards.

2. ComplianceQuest

Image source: compliancequest.com
ComplianceQuest is a cloud-based solution used by manufacturing companies that manage high volumes of quality activity and reporting.
The platform uses a shared data model to handle audits, inspections, corrective actions, and change activity in one system.
Quality teams review quality metrics and trends using real-time data instead of static reports, which supports issue review and follow-up.
Key Features
- Audit planning, scheduling, execution, and report generation
- Corrective action and preventive action (CAPA) with root cause analysis and effectiveness review
- Nonconformance management with investigation workflows and escalation logic
- Change control with documented workflows and impact assessment
- Equipment management for calibration and preventive maintenance tracking
- Product inspection for receiving, in-process, and finished goods
- Management review dashboards with quality metrics
ComplianceQuest connects quality workflows with enterprise applications commonly used in manufacturing environments. Organizations use this setup for reporting and compliance activities.
3. SimplerQMS

Image source: simplerqms.com
Organizations use SimplerQMS in regulated manufacturing, including life sciences, where document history and audit preparation carry heavy weight.
The system manages quality processes through predefined workflows that connect documents, training tasks, audits, nonconformances, and corrective actions in one place.
Document control is the core of SimplerQMS. Users create, review, approve, distribute, and archive documents through automated workflows.
Every version carries a time-stamped audit trail, and only approved versions remain available.
Electronic signatures that meet FDA 21 CFR Part 11 and EU Annex 11 requirements support remote approvals without paper handling.
Key Features
- Document management with version control and audit trails
- Training management tied to released and updated documents
- Change management with workflow-based review and approval
- Audit management for internal, external, and supplier audits
- Nonconformance handling with escalation to CAPA
- Risk management documentation with traceability matrices
- Supplier management tool for quality documentation and monitoring
Quality data flows through linked workflows that connect documents, training records, nonconformances, CAPAs, and risk files in one system.
This setup helps organizations maintain consistent product quality and manage regulatory expectations.
4. EASE

Image source: ease.io
EASE is a cloud-based platform used in manufacturing to run digital audits and inspections and track corrective actions.
It’s commonly used for quality audits, safety inspections, and operational checks while collecting consistent data from one or multiple sites.
Audits run on mobile devices, even offline. Users capture findings, photos, and videos during the audit, then assign follow-up tasks immediately.
Each finding connects to an action plan, an owner, and validation tasks, so corrective work remains connected to the original audit.
Scheduling covers one-time and recurring audits for sites, areas, lines, or stations. This helps apply the same audit standards at different locations without manual coordination.
Key Features
- Mobile audits and inspections with offline access
- Configurable audit templates by site, area, and workstation
- Scheduling for recurring and ad hoc audits
- Question randomization to improve data collection accuracy
- Action plans with task assignment and validation tracking
- Root cause analysis tasks linked to audit findings
- Photo, video, and attachment capture during inspections
- Dashboards and reports for single-site and multi-site review
EASE focuses on audits, follow-up actions, and reporting rather than full quality system coverage.
Reports combine results from multiple locations so teams can spot patterns, address performance gaps, and maintain continuous quality improvement.
5. Advantive

Image source: advantive.com
Advantive focuses on product testing, inspection, and traceability during production rather than post-production review.
Quality test requirements are set electronically by the plant, product specification, customer, or job.
Test results are captured directly from connected testing devices when available. This reduces manual entry and keeps inspection records connected to production activity.
Quality managers can review inspection results before shipment and reference documented results when handling customer complaints or returns.
Key Features
- Electronic setup of quality test requirements by plant, product, or customer
- Product testing with direct data capture from testing equipment
- In-process and finished goods inspection with recorded results
- Product traceability linked to jobs, materials, and specifications
- Certificates of Conformance (COC) and Certificates of Analysis (COA) generation
- Alerts when required tests are skipped or when results are missing
- Integration with inventory, production planning, and material management
- Support for ISO requirements and documented quality processes
Advantive’s QMS operates within a broader manufacturing software environment, connecting quality data with inventory usage, production planning, and material flow.
This connection keeps test results linked to production outcomes and maintains consistent product quality in industries such as automotive manufacturing.
6. QT9

Image source: qt9software.com
QT9 is a flexible QMS platform that covers document control, audits, corrective actions, training, calibration, supplier quality, and product traceability.
The system keeps quality activity linked to manufacturing operations instead of handling it separately.
Quality events such as nonconformances, corrective actions, supplier issues, training status, and calibration records remain traceable through reports and dashboards.
This helps maintain closed-loop quality, where issues link to actions, follow-up, and history.
QT9 also provides secure portals for customers, suppliers, and employees to access quality documents and records.
Key Features
- CAPA workflows with root cause tracking
- Audit management for internal and external audits
- Nonconformance reporting with risk assessment and escalation
- Supplier qualification and performance tracking
- Employee training matrices and certification tracking
- Equipment calibration, scheduling, and maintenance records
- Product traceability from raw materials through finished goods
- Quality dashboards and key performance indicators (KPIs)
QT9 also offers material requirements planning (MRP) and ERP software. QT9 MRP handles scheduling, inventory, work orders, and purchasing while integrating with accounting systems such as QuickBooks or Xero.
QT9 ERP adds accounting and financial reporting, creating an integrated solution that connects quality, production, and inventory data.
7. Qualityze

Image source: qualityze.com
Qualityze is an enterprise quality management system (eQMS) used in manufacturing to manage compliance, supplier quality management, and safety workflows.
It covers industry standards and regulations such as ISO 9001, ISO 45001, and ISO 50001.
Qualityze uses configurable workflows for nonconformance management, CAPA, audit management, document control, equipment calibration, and incident reporting.
Key Features
- Document control with workflow automation, version control, and access controls
- Nonconformance management with routing and investigation tracking
- Audit management for internal assessments and certification activity
- Equipment calibration and maintenance scheduling with notifications
- Safety incident and near-miss management with investigation workflows
- Configurable workflows and fields for internal process requirements
- Cloud-based platform with automatic updates and system integrations
- AI assistant for workflow guidance and issue analysis
Qualityze is often reviewed by manufacturers that deal with regulatory changes, supplier risk, and safety reporting.
The focus is on compliance requirements and process management that helps maintain customer satisfaction, protect brand reputation, and reduce costs.
